ABOUT THE ROLE
As a Senior Electrical Engineer specializing in MV and LV system design, you will be responsible for designing electrical systems that power and support high-density facilities. You will ensure that conductor sizes are optimized for performance and efficiency, accounting for various support mediums (e.g., cable trays, conduits) and environmental factors.
You will work closely with other engineers and construction teams to implement robust electrical infrastructure, ensuring compliance with industry standards and safety requirements. This role reports to the Senior Vice President, Development.
Some of the key responsibilities you should expect are the following:
- Medium Voltage Design: Design, analyze, and optimize medium voltage (MV) overhead lines and underground systems, ensuring reliable power distribution and adherence to safety and regulatory standards.
- Low Voltage Design: Design and optimize high-density low voltage (LV) systems to ensure proper electrical distribution, particularly in data centers and similar facilities.
- Conductor Sizing: Size electrical conductors (both MV and LV) based on load requirements, considering factors such as cable tray spacing, conduit installation, temperature derating, and voltage drop.
- Voltage Drop & Derating Analysis: Perform detailed voltage drop calculations, considering cable lengths, load demands, and environmental factors (e.g., temperature, insulation material), to ensure system efficiency and reliability.
- Support Mediums: Design and select appropriate support mediums (cable trays, conduits, ducts) for various conductor installations, optimizing for space and ensuring the integrity of the electrical system.
- Cable Tray Design: Ensure proper layout and design of cable trays for safe and efficient conductor placement, considering accessibility for maintenance, load-bearing capacity, and space optimization.
- System Coordination: Work closely with mechanical, civil, and MEP engineers to ensure alignment of electrical system designs with other infrastructure elements, particularly in high-density environments.
- Construction Support: Provide technical guidance during the construction phase to ensure designs are accurately implemented, addressing any site-specific challenges or modifications.
- Standards & Regulations: Ensure all designs comply with relevant electrical codes, safety standards (e.g., NEC, IEEE, IEC), and environmental regulations.
